Maxxis Carnivore RT 28x10-14 (8ply) Radial Tires on MSA M43 Fang Titanium Tint Wheels
Upgrade your ATV or UTV with the Maxxis Carnivore RT 28x10-14 (8ply) Radial Tires mounted on sleek MSA M43 Fang Titanium Tint Wheels. This set of 4 tires comes complete with 4 rims, lug nuts, and center caps by Wild Boar for a durable and stylish off-road riding experience.
Key Features:
- Maxxis Carnivore RT 28x10-14 tires provide excellent traction and control in various terrains
- MSA M43 Fang Titanium Tint Wheels offer a rugged yet eye-catching design
- 8-ply radial construction for enhanced strength and durability
What's Included:
- 4 Maxxis Carnivore RT 28x10-14 (8ply) Radial Tires
- 4 MSA M43 Fang Titanium Tint Wheels with lug nuts and center caps

| Tire and Wheel Kit Specs | |
| Brand | Maxxis Carnivore RT Tires / MSA Wheels |
| Tire Specs | |
| Tire Height | 28" |
| Tire Width | 10" |
| Wheel Specs | |
| Wheel Color | Titanium Tint |
| Wheel Size | 14" |
| Wheel Type | Non-Beadlock |
